AUK Dean of CEAS Gives Keynote Speech at KIPIC

The dean of the College of Engineering and Applied Sciences (CEAS), Dr. Amir Zeid, at AUK, delivered a keynote speech at the Kuwait Integrated Petroleum Industries Company (KIPIC) headquarters in Al-Zour. The title of the speech was "A conversation with ChatGPT: Exploring Future Opportunities and Applications,” where he addressed the myths of AI, ethical concerns, and demonstrated the newly-released ChatGPT 4.0 and its related applications. 
 
Dean Zeid highlighted the potential benefits of ChatGPT in the oil industry and how it could revolutionize various business domains, including education. He also discussed the common misconceptions about AI and emphasized the importance of ethical considerations when using such technology. 
 
The event was attended by representatives from KIPIC, as well as other industry leaders and members of the academic community. Dean Zeid's keynote speech was well-received and sparked a lively discussion among attendees about the future of ChatGPT and its potential applications.
